Deandre Ayton has been crushing defenses since his return from an illness and Atlanta's woeful defense won't change that. Phoenix's big man takes focus in our Hawks vs. Suns picks tonight.

The total on tonight’s game has been consistent, opening at 231.5 and staying at that number at most sites throughout the day.

That number suggests that oddsmakers expect Atlanta to dictate the pace of play tonight. The Hawks are playing to an average total of 233 points, while the Suns are hovering around 223.5. Phoenix has only played one game that went over 230 points over its past seven, and that was in an overtime win over the Spurs.

On the other hand, Atlanta has been playing to even bigger totals than normal lately. The Hawks have hit the Over in seven of their last eight games, going over tonight’s total in six of those contests. In four of those games, the Hawks have obliterated the total, going Over by at least 20 points in regulation. There’s a definite trend here, with only the slowest teams being able to keep the score down against Atlanta.

The Hawks probably won’t be able to push the Suns into a true shootout tonight. That said, Phoenix is going to try to take advantage of the weak Atlanta defense, particularly by feeding Ayton inside. I think the Over is the smart play given how the Hawks have played in recent weeks, but this feels like the least confident bet of the night.The Suns are 6-1 against the spread in their last seven games overall.
